SilverSea Ships
Silversea ships carry between 296 to 388 passengers and are designed to incorporate the very best elements of first class cruising: open, single seating dining in The Restaurant (the main dining room), Saletta, La Terrazza (indoor/outdoor café), a Pool Grillé, plus 24-hour in-suite dining are offered. An elaborate show lounge (an element missing on other small luxury ships)for nightly entertainment, an Italian crew and European staff; exquisite decor; superb service and cuisine; and luxurious all suite accommodations, 75 percent featuring private verandas.
Silver Cloud and Silver Wind are sister ships built in 1994 and 1995. They are 16800 tons in size, carry an Italian Crew of 210 which cater to 260 guests. The ships offer six different types of suites, ranging in size from almost 250 square feet to over 1,300. Each suite is decorated in hushed pastels and warm hues displaying a rare degree of finesse and refinement and every suite features a marbled bath with a full-sized tub. They are described as intimate, elegant, warm, comfortable and eminently refined, yet with relaxed luxury.
Silver Shadow and Silver Whisper are also sister ships. Silver Shadow the first of these spectacular new ships was launched in September 2000, followed by sister ship Silver Whisper in July, 2001. These new ships sparkle with promise and delicious details that you expect in first class cruising. They are slightly larger at 25000 tons but also carry an Italian Crew of 295 catering to 388 guests. Beautifully appointed, every suite features a marbled bathroom with double vanity, full-sized bathtub and separate shower. In all there are seven different types of suites ranging in size from 287 square feet to over 1,400. Most suites, with the exception of the Vista suites have a teak deck balcony.
